FARESMITH RULES ENGINE — review notes. Shipping-fee rules compile to a decision table at deploy; reviewers must confirm rule priority ordering, since the first match wins and zone overlaps are common. Run the golden-cart suite before approving — it replays 400 historical carts against the candidate table and diffs fees. The suite fetches reference rates from the internal tariff service, which authenticates every request. For review runs against staging, use the key provided below.

API key for yahig-tadup: kto7_ubizbYm

### Step 4: Verify the pagination service bundle

Before deploying the Pagecourse API update, confirm the bundle handling cursor-based pagination is signed. Support sees ticket spikes when unsigned builds slip through and page tokens break. Run the verify command against the staging artifact first. Verification requires the current deploy key, provided below.

deploy key for kajof-fajop: bky6_gDHw9Q

Onboarding note for the Ledgerpane admin table: bulk edits are applied through the batcher service, not directly against the database. Select rows, choose an action, and the batcher stages changes in a pending set you can review before commit. Edits over 500 rows require a second approver — this is enforced server-side, so don't try to chunk around it. To run the batcher locally you need the staging write credential, which goes in your .env as the next line.

secret setting of bahip-kagag: RELAY_SECRET3=c83